How EINs are Assigned and Valid EIN Prefixes Canceling an EIN Closing Your Account Who is a Responsible Party? 2 What is an EIN An Employer Identification Number (EIN) is also known as a Federal Tax Identification Number, and is used to identify a business entity Generally, businesses need an EIN A taxpayer may apply for an EIN in various ways including online The service is free service offered by the Internal Revenue Service some offer the service for a fee, but IRS is FREE Generally using the online version, the EIN is assigned immediately 3 1

2 Basics An Employer Identification Number (EIN) is a ninedigit number that IRS assigns in the following format: XX-XXXXXXX It is used to identify the tax accounts of employers and certain others who have no employees For employee plans, an alpha (for example, P) or the plan number (e.g., 003) may follow the EIN The IRS uses the number to identify taxpayers that are required to file various business tax returns 4 Campus 5 Basics EINs are used by employers, sole proprietors, corporations, partnerships, non-profit associations, trusts, estates of decedents, government agencies, certain individuals, and other business entities Use the EIN on all of the items that are sent to the IRS and the Social Security Administration (SSA). Caution: An EIN is for use in connection with business activities only Do not use the EIN in place of a social security number (SSN) 6 2

3 One EIN Per Day Effective May 21, 2012, to ensure fair and equitable treatment for all taxpayers, the Internal Revenue Service will limit Employer Identification Number (EIN) issuance to one per responsible party per day This limitation is applicable to all requests for EINs whether online or by fax or mail 7 One EIN for Enitity The client should have only one EIN for the same business entity Numerous Sole Proprietorships can operate under one EIN 8 Special Rules Regarding Entity Classification Elections There are special rules and procedures for classification elections made on Form 8832, Entity Classification Election 9 3

4 Form 8832 An eligible entity uses Form 8832 to elect how it will be classified for federal tax purposes, as a corporation, a partnership, or an entity disregarded as separate from its owner An eligible entity is classified for federal tax purposes under the default rules unless it files Form 8832 or Form 2553, Election by a Small Business Corporation See Who Must File 10 below. The IRS will use the information Center entered for Agricultural on Law & Taxation thi f t t bli h th tit fili d Who Must File- Form 8832 The IRS will use the information entered on the form to establish the entity s filing and reporting requirements for federal tax purposes An entity must file Form 2553 if making an election under section 1362(a) to be an S corporation A new eligible entity should not file Form 8832 if it will be using its default classification 11 Domestic Default Rule Unless an election is made on Form 8832, a domestic eligible entity is: 1. A partnership if it has two or more members. 2. Disregarded as an entity separate from its owner if it has a single owner A change in the number of members of an eligible entity classified as an association does not affect the entity s classification - For purposes of this form, an association is an eligible entity taxable as a corporation by election or, for foreign eligible entities, under the default rules(see Regulations section ). However, an eligible entity classified as a partnership will become a disregarded entity when the entity s membership is reduced to one member and a disregarded entity will be classified as a partnership when the entity has more than one member. 12 4

5 Online Application 13 Online Application The client must complete the application in one session, as they will not be able to save and return at a later time For security purposes, the session will expire after 15 minutes of inactivity, and the client will need to start over The EIN will be received immediately upon verification If the client wishes to receive the confirmation letter online, it is strongly recommended that they install Adobe Reader before beginning the application if it is not already installed 14 Online Application If a third party designee (TPD) is completing the online application on behalf of the taxpayer, the taxpayer must authorize the third party to apply for and receive the EIN on his or her behalf The business location must be within the United States or U.S. territories Foreign filers without an Individual Taxpayer Identification Number (ITIN) cannot use this assistant to obtain an EIN If the entity is incorporated outside of the United States or the U.S. territories, they cannot apply for an EIN online Call

8 Form SS-4 22 Form SS-4 23 Typical Times an EIN is Needed Start a new business Hire employees Open a bank account bank needs for banking purpose Change the type of organization Purchase an ongoing business Create a trust Created a pension plan as a plan administrator A foreign person needing an EIN to comply with IRS withholding regulations The administration of an estate Is a withholding agent for taxes on non-wage income paid to an alien (i.e., individual, corporation, or partnership, etc.) A state or local agency Is a single-member LLC Is an S corporation 24 8

9 Sounds Simple 25 Start a New Business A a sole proprietorship or self-employed farmer who establishes a qualified retirement plan, or is required to file excise, employment, alcohol, tobacco, or firearms returns, must have an EIN A partnership, corporation, REMIC (real estate mortgage investment conduit), nonprofit organization (church, club, etc.), or farmers cooperative must use an EIN for any tax-related purpose even if the entity does not have employees 26 Change the Type of Organization Either the legal character of the organization or its ownership changed (for example, you incorporate a sole proprietorship or form a partnership) However, do not apply for a new EIN if the existing entity only (a) changed its business name (b) elected on Form 8832 to change the way it is taxed (or is covered by the default rules), or (c) terminated its partnership status because at least 50% of the total interests in partnership capital and profits were sold or exchanged within a 12-month period The EIN of the terminated partnership should continue to be used. Regulations section (d)(2)(iii) 27 9

10 Purchases an Ongoing Business Never ever use the current businesses EIN Apply for an EIN under the business name This starts a new record and could become important if the other business owes back taxes or incurred penalties the client is unaware of at the time of purchase Create the businesses own history, do not be burden by old issues Exception, if you became the owner of a corporation by acquiring its stock 28 Created a Trust The trust is other than a grantor trust or an IRA trust However, grantor trusts that do not file using Optional Method 1 and IRA trusts that are required to file Form 990-T, Exempt Organization Business Income Tax Return, must have an EIN 29 Created a Pension Plan as a Plan Administrator A plan administrator is the person or group of persons specified as the administrator by the instrument under which the plan is operated Needs an EIN for reporting purposes 30 10

11 Is a Foreign Person Needing an EIN to Comply with IRS Withholding Regulations Needs an EIN to complete a Form W-8 (other than Form W-8ECI), avoid withholding on portfolio assets, or claim tax treaty benefits Entities applying to be a Qualified Intermediary (QI) need a QI-EIN even if they already have an EIN, see Rev. Proc Administering an estate Needs an EIN to report estate income on Form A State or Local Agency Serves as a tax reporting agent for public assistance recipients under Rev. Proc. 80-4, If the taxpayer is an agent of a household employer that is a disabled individual or other welfare recipient receiving home care services through a state or local program, check the box Other and enter Household employer agent Rev. Proc and Rev. Proc If you're a state or local government, also check the box for state/local government State or local agencies may need an EIN for other reasons, for example, hired employees 33 11

12 A Single-Member LLC Needs an EIN to file Form 8832, Classification Election, for filing employment tax returns and excise tax returns, or for state reporting purposes 34 Disregarded Entities A disregarded entity is an eligible entity that is disregarded as separate from its owner for federal income tax purposes Disregarded entities include single-member limited liability companies (LLCs) that are disregarded as separate from their owners, qualified subchapter S subsidiaries (qualified subsidiaries of an S corporation), and certain qualified foreign entities 35 Disregarded Entities The disregarded entity is required to use its name and EIN for reporting and payment of employment taxes A disregarded entity is also required to use its name and EIN to register for excise tax activities on Form 637; pay and report excise taxes reported on Forms 720, 730, 2290, and 11-C; and claim any refunds, credits, and payments on Form

13 Disregarded Entities If a disregarded entity is filing Form SS-4 to obtain an EIN because it is required to report and pay employment and excise taxes, or for non-federal purposes such as a state requirement, check the box Other for line 9a and write Disregarded entity (or Disregarded entity-sole proprietorship if the owner of the disregarded entity is an individual) 37 Disregarded Entities If the disregarded entity is requesting an EIN for purposes of filing Form 8832 to elect classification as an association taxable as a corporation, or Form 2553 to elect S corporation status, check the box Corporation for line 9a and write Single-member and the form number of the return that will be filed (Form 1120 or 1120S). If the disregarded entity is requesting an EIN because it has acquired one or more additional owners and its classification has changed to partnership under the default rules of Regulations section (f), check the box Partnership for line 9a 38 An S corporation Needs an EIN to file Form 2553, Election by a Small Business Corporation An existing corporation that is electing or revoking S corporation status should use its previouslyassigned EIN 39 13

14 Tips When Applying 40 Tips When using the online system do not use any symbols Address is limited to 35 characters- provide the most essential address information (i.e., apartment numbers, suite numbers, etc IRS will validate using the information entered If incorporated outside of the United States or the U.S. territories, you cannot apply for an EIN online All the EINs obtained on the Internet start with 20, 26, 27, 45, 46, 47, 81 or Tips No special software is needed The client may be required to enroll in EFTPS if they meet specific requirements For NEW Businesses IRS has a program called : Express Enrollment All businesses receiving a new EIN (Employer Identification Number) are pre-enrolled in the Electronic Federal Tax Payment System (EFTPS) enabling them to make all federal tax payments electronically at The EFTPS PIN package is mailed to the IRS address of record. (If less than 1 week since receiving your EIN) please wait, the PIN should arrive within 5 business days after receiving the EIN If more than one week since receiving your EIN, call EFTPS Customer Service at

15 Activating Enrollment in EFTPS Instructions for activating are included in the EFTPS PIN package Follow the steps in the How to Activate Your Enrollment brochure we have detailed them below 1. Call and follow the automated instructions 2. Enter financial institution information (bank routing and account number) 3. Choose whether or not the taxpayer wished to have EFTPS verify the bank Information If they choose to verify the bank account information it will delay making a payment for 6-10 business days If they choose not to have the bank account number verified, they can begin making payments immediately after all activation steps have been complete The taxpayer is responsible for the accuracy of the number entered If it is incorrect, the financial institution may return the payment and the client may incur an IRS penalty for late payment. 43 Activating Enrollment in EFTPS 4. Authorize withdrawal of electronic payments from bank account 5. Enter phone number 6. Write down the confirmation number 7. The voice response system will offer the option of obtaining an Internet Password so you can make payments via the Internet 8. Within 7-10 days, taxpayers will receive an EFTPS Confirmation/Update Package by mail that contains a Confirmation/Update Form and an EFTPS Payment Instruction Booklet 44 Lost or Forgotten EIN IRS records will be updated immediately with the EIN Calling (800) and select EIN from the list of options Once connected with an IRS employee, explain the lost or forgotten situation The IRS employee will ask the necessary disclosure and security questions prior to providing the number 45 15

17 Sole Proprietorship The client will be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true. They are subject to a bankruptcy proceeding They incorporate They take in partners and operate as a partnership They purchase or inherit an existing business that will be operated as sole proprietorship 49 Sole Proprietorship The client will not be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true They change the name of the business They change the location and/or add other locations They operate multiple businesses as sole proprietorships 50 Changing Name How to Report Business owners and other authorized individuals can submit a name change for their business The specific action required may vary depending on the type of business If the EIN was recently assigned and filing liability has yet to be determined, send Business Name Change requests to IRS-Stop 343, Cincinnati, OH In some situations a name change may require a new Employer Identification Number (EIN) or a final return 51 17

18 Chart to Assist 52 Change of Address and How to Report Form 8822-B 53 Corporations The client will be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true A corporation receives a new charter from the secretary of state The corporation is a subsidiary of a corporation using the parent's EIN or they become a subsidiary of a corporation They change to a partnership or a sole proprietorship A new corporation is created after a statutory merger 54 18

19 Corporations The client will not be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true They are a division of a corporation The surviving corporation uses the existing EIN after a corporate merger A corporation declares bankruptcy The corporate name or location changes A corporation chooses to be taxed as an S corporation Reorganization of a corporation changes only the identity or place Conversion at the state level with business structure remaining unchanged 55 Partnerships The client will be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true They incorporate The partnership is taken over by one of the partners and is operated as a sole proprietorship They end an old partnership and begin a new one 56 Partnerships The client will not be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true The partnership declares bankruptcy The partnership name changes They change the location of the partnership or add other locations A new partnership is formed as a result of the termination of a partnership under IRC 708(b)(1)(B) 50 % or more of the ownership of the partnership (measured by interests in capital and profits) changes hands within a twelvemonth period (terminated partnerships under Reg ) 57 19

20 Limited Liability Company (LLC) An LLC is an entity created by state statute The IRS did not create a new tax classification for the LLC when it was created by the states Instead IRS uses the tax entity classifications it has always had for business taxpayers: Corporation Partnership, or Disregarded as an entity separate from its owner, referred to as a disregarded entity 58 Limited Liability Company (LLC) An LLC is always classified by the IRS as one of these types of taxable entities If a disregarded entity is owned by an individual, it is treated as a sole proprietor If the disregarded entity is owned by any other entity, it is treated as a branch or division of its owner 59 Changes affecting Single Member LLCs with Employees or Other Taxes For wages paid on or after January 1, 2009, single member/single owner LLCs that have not elected to be treated as corporations may be required to change the way they report and pay federal employment taxes and wage payments and certain federal excise taxes On Aug. 16, 2007, changes to Treasury Regulation were issued The new regulations state that the LLC, not its single owner, will be responsible for filing and paying all employment taxes on wages paid on or after January 1, 2009 These regulations also state that for certain excise taxes, the LLC, not its single owner, will be responsible for liabilities imposed and actions first required or permitted in periods beginning on or after January 1,

21 Changes affecting Single Member LLCs with Employees or Other Taxes If a single member LLC has been filing and paying employment taxes under the name and EIN of the owner, and no EIN was previously assigned to the LLC, a new EIN will be required for wages on or after January 1, 2009 and excise tax paid on or after January 1, Examples If the primary name on the account is John Doe, a new EIN will be required If the primary name on the account is John Doe and the second name line is Doe Plumbing (which was organized as an LLC under state law), a new EIN is required If the primary name on the account is Doe Plumbing LLC, a new EIN will not be required 62 Changes affecting Single Member LLCs with Employees or Other Taxes The client will be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true A new LLC with more than one owner (Multi-member LLC) is formed under state law A new LLC with one owner (Single Member LLC) is formed under state law and chooses to be taxed as a corporation or an S corporation A new LLC with one owner (Single Member LLC) is formed under state law, and has an excise tax filing requirement for tax periods beginning on or after January 1, 2008 or an employment tax filing requirement for wages paid on or after January 1,

22 Changes affecting Single Member LLCs with Employees or Other Taxes The client will not be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true They report income tax as a branch or division of a corporation or other entity, and the LLC has no employees or excise tax liability An existing partnership converts to an LLC classified as a partnership The LLC name or location changes. An LLC that already has an EIN chooses to be taxed as a corporation or as an S corporation A new LLC with one owner (single member LLC) is formed under state law, does not choose to be taxed as a corporation or S corporation, and has no employees or excise tax liability NOTE: You may request an EIN for banking or state tax purposes, but an EIN is not required for federal tax purposes 64 Estates The client will be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true A trust is created with funds from the estate (not simply a continuation of the estate) The client represents an estate that operates a business after the owner's death The client will not be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statement is true The administrator, personal representative, or executor changes his/her name or address 65 Trusts The client will be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true One person is the grantor/maker of many trusts A trust changes to an estate A living or intervivos trust changes to a testamentary trust A living trust terminates by distributing its property to a residual trust 66 22

23 Trusts The client will not be required to obtain a new EIN if any of the following statements are true The trustee changes The grantor or beneficiary changes his/her name or address 67 Change in Fiduciary's Address If the same fiduciary who filed the prior year's return (or Form SS-4 if this is the first return being filed) files the current year's return and changed the address on the return (including a change to an "in care of" name and address), and didn't report the change on Form 8822-B, the appropriate box on Form 1041 If the address shown on Form 1041 changes after fining the form (including a change to an "in care of" name and address), file Form 8822-B to notify the IRS of the change 68 Change of Name or Address 69 23

24 Change of Name or Address If the fiduciary changed his or her name from the name that he or she entered on the prior year's return (or Form SS-4 if this is the first return being filed), be sure to check the required box on Form Current Systemic - Return Due Dates Provided on CP575 Notices If you have recently applied for a Federal Identification Number, some of the return due dates are wrong on the assignment notice of the EIN the client will receive Due to a change in return due dates for Partnerships and certain Corporations, the CP575 notice may be incorrect for tax periods ending after 12/31/2015 When you apply for a client or the client brings in the CP 575 please review for accuracy. Sample below with the wrong filing date for a calendar year corporation When filing any tax return, use the most current version of the form and instructions for the entity type to ensure timely filing
